    Maybe they sent their seconds to Canada. I thought about buying a 1947 12 gauge field that I looked at in Edmonton, Alberta that was in great shape, except for two things. A previous owner thought it was a good idea to engrave his social insurance number on the side plates, frame, barrels and forend, and the barrels had the most pronounced rivelling I have ever seen. The bores were smooth, but looking along the side of the barrels toward a light showed continous rolls of rivelling. Too bad. It had at least 95% colour and hardly looked like it had been shot.
